Ingredients of Peanut Butter Oatmeal Cookies🍪
- Prepare 1/2 cup of peanut butter.
- It's 1/2 cup of brown sugar.
- It's 1/3 cup of cane sugar.
- Prepare 3/4 Cups of flour.
- You need 3/4 Cups of Instant Oats.
- It's 1/2 Cup of Butter.
- You need 1 tsp of Vanilla extract.
- Prepare 1/4 tsp of salt.
- You need 3/4 tsp of Baking Powder.
- You need 1 of egg.

Peanut Butter Oatmeal Cookies🍪 step by step
- Gather ingredients. In a medium mixing bowl add in butter, peanut butter, cane sugar, and brown sugar. Mix until smooth in appearance.
- Add in vanilla extract and egg. Mix together until smooth..
- Next add in oats, flour, backing powder, and mix until well combined..
- Cover cookie dough and let rest in the fridge for 30min-2hrs. After cookie dough is ready to bake. Preheat oven at 350*. Scoop cookies into small balls placed about 2inch. Apart on a well greased cookie sheet..
- Let cookies bake for 8-10min. Place cookies on a cookie rack or plate to cool. Enjoy!.
